Paul Robinson

Chief Operating Officer, Executive Vice President and General Counsel, Comverse Technology, Inc.

New York, New York, United States

About

Supervise and manage operations for Comverse Technology, Inc. (NASDAQ: CMVT), an S&P 500 and NASDAQ-100 Index company, and numerous subsidiaries worldwide. Report directly to the Board of Directors. Advise and provide counsel on a full array of legal matters, including SEC, corporate governance, regulatory, merger and acquisition, contract, intellectual property, litigation, employment, operational and strategic planning issues. Prepare and review all public filings. Provide litigation direction and support from pre-trial process and strategy through settlement negotiations and trials. Supervise and manage in-house legal departments and outside legal counsel.
